Actually, LCDs are transmissive by nature. Put a mirror behind it, and it becomes reflective. This is how digital watches and calculators have worked for ages, though the "mirror" is not a smooth, shiny reflector for practical reasons. Today you can have a transreflective display with both a backlight and a mirror, thanks to improved light transmission through the LCD.

I've had the pleasure of getting my hands on a One Laptop Per Child XO-1 laptop (which uses a Pixel Qi display).
I'm relatively sure they were shooting it in color backlit mode in that footage. When you put a Pixel Qi display in sunlight/under bright lights, it'll look like classic black and white LCD even when the backlight is on. When you move it back into the shade/low-light, you'll see the backlit pixels in color again. The nice thing about it is that even if you don't turn off the backlight, it'll still be sunlight readable.
Even nicer is that if you turn off the backlight, the display will look like those old black & white Nintendo Game & Watch or Gameboy LCDs and it consumes so little power, extending battery life tons.
